Biological pest control brand is a method of controlling pests like insects, mites, weeds and plant diseases using other organisms.  It depends on predation, parasitism, herbivory, or other all-natural mechanisms, but typically also involves an active individual management role.  It can be an important part of integrated pest management (IPM) programs. Biological control is the use of natural enemies (predators, parasites/parasitoids, pathogens as microbial insecticides) to suppress insects. Biological practices include employing one organism to control an individual, as in bringing or releasing beneficial insects that are natural enemies of insect species into the scene and protecting the beneficial organisms that exist in the landscape.  Biological control tactics incorporate the importation, conservation, and enhancement of natural enemies. There are three primary strategies for biological pest management: ancient (importation), where a natural enemy of a pest is introduced into the expectation of attaining control; inductive (augmentation), where a large population of natural enemies are administered for quick pest control; and inoculative (conservation), where measures are taken to maintain natural enemies via routine reestablishment. The most usual system of pest control would be using pesticideschemicals that either kill insects or inhibit their growth.  Pesticides are often classified based on the pest they are intended to control. Chemical pesticides are frequently used to control diseases, pests or weeds.  Chemical control relies on materials which are toxic (poisonous) to the insects involved.  When chemical pesticides are employed to protect plants from pests, diseases or overgrowth by weeds, we now talk of plant protection products.

Following are ten guidelines for the exterior and interior of your property. The fewer pests you have feeding, harboring, or breeding outdoors your home, the fewer concerns you will have inside. Eliminating circumstances in your house that appeal to pests will help reduce the attraction that brings them in and avert harm in your home.

Plants and Mulch

Trim back any tree branches or shrubbery that touch your property to get rid of pest “bridges” to the property. Mulch, such as wood chips and pine straw, provide ideal shelter for pests. As an alternative of making use of these in areas that touch your foundation, location significantly less pest-appealing ground cover, such as rock or stone.

Doors and Windows

Because pests can wiggle through tiny cracks and gaps, inspect and repair any warped or broken doors and windows, and these that basically don't match well; repair rips or tears in screens. Use screen meshes size of at least 200 holes per square inch; these are normally available at property shops.

Cracks and Gaps

Inspect the whole exterior of your property for other cracks, crevices, and gaps via which pests could enter. Check for foundation cracks, loose siding, missing roof shingles, and gaps about incoming utility lines, including pipes, electric and cable wiring. Seal any openings with copper mesh, coarse steel wool, sheet metal or mortar. Expanding caulk is not as excellent to use due to the fact several pests can chew by means of it.

Trash and Litter

Keep yards, patios, decks, and garages free of litter, weeds, and standing water. Guarantee trash cans have tight-fitting lids and clean the cans and area routinely to get rid of debris and spills, on which pests can feed.

Lights

To lessen flying insects about doors and windows, replace standard mercury vapor lights with higher-stress sodium vapor or halogen lights. Bulbs that have pink, yellow or orange tints will be least appealing to the flying insects. Though it is widespread to spot lights on exterior walls near doors, it is far better to spot the light farther away, using pole lights when feasible, with the light shining toward the door for security.

Interior Gaps

Some cracks and gaps will be visible only from inside your home. Verify in, below and behind kitchen cabinets, refrigerators, and stoves, as properly as among the floor and wall juncture and around pipes, floor and dryer vents. Seal any gaps found, particularly those of 1/4 inch or greater.

Drains

Sink and floor drains typically accumulate gunk and debris which can appeal to pests and supply an best breeding website, especially for modest flies. Inspect and maintain all sink, tub, basement and laundry area floor drains.

Recycled Objects

It is preferable to store recyclables outside and away from your property. If this is not possible, guarantee that all containers are completely rinsed and that the recycling bin has a tight-fitting lid. All recycling and trash containers need to also be rodent evidence and cleaned often. Stored Food items If opened bags and boxes cannot be entirely closed, the meals need to be put into a resealable bag or plastic container to maintain from attracting stored solution (or "pantry") pests that invade the kitchen. Use older meals first and clean out stale or uneaten foods to aid maintain attractants down.

Cleanliness

The cleaner your residence, the significantly less attraction it will have for pests, the much less possibility a pest will have to reside and breed – and the much less probably it will be that you would need to have to go on the defense and pull out a can of bug spray or call a pest handle professional

Try pest prevention 1st. •    Remove sources of food, water and shelter. •    Store food in sealed plastic or glass containers. Garbage containing meals scraps must be positioned in tightly covered trash cans. Eliminate garbage regularly from your residence. •    Fix leaky plumbing and don't allow water accumulate anyplace in the house. Don't let water gather in trays below your home plants or fridge. Don't leave pet meals and water out overnight. •    Clutter gives locations for pests to breed and hide and makes it difficult to get rid of them. Get rid of things like stacks of newspapers, magazines, or cardboard. •    Close off locations the place pests can enter and hide. For example, caulk cracks and crevices around cabinets or baseboards. Use steel wool to fill spaces close to pipes. Cover any holes with wire mesh. •    Learn about the pests you have and possibilities to manage them. •    Check for pests in packages or boxes prior to carrying them into your home. Do safely and accurately use pesticides. •    Keep pets and kids away from locations exactly where pesticides have been utilized. •    After preventive steps have been taken, you can use baits as a initial line of chemical defense against insects or rodents. o    These are frequently efficient and can be utilized with lower danger of exposure to the pesticide, as prolonged as they are kept out of the reach of youngsters and pets. •    Other reasonably low-threat pesticides are accessible for some pests.
